What is a bio data form for an interview?
A bio data form for an interview is a document that provides essential information about a candidate. It includes personal details, educational background, work experience, skills, and other relevant information that helps the interviewer assess the candidate's suitability for the job.
What are the types of bio data form for an interview?
There are several types of bio data forms for an interview, including:
Traditional Bio Data Form: This type of form follows a standard format and includes sections for personal details, educational qualifications, work experience, skills, and references.
Structured Bio Data Form: This form is designed with specific categories and subheadings to provide a systematic way of organizing the candidate's information.
Online Bio Data Form: With the advent of technology, online bio data forms have become popular. These forms can be filled out electronically and submitted online.
Customized Bio Data Form: Some organizations may have their own customized bio data forms tailored to their specific requirements and job roles.
How to complete a bio data form for an interview
Completing a bio data form for an interview is crucial to make a positive impression. Here are some steps to help you:
01
Read the instructions carefully before filling out the form.
02
Provide accurate and up-to-date information.
03
Organize your information in a clear and concise manner.
04
Include relevant details about your educational qualifications, work experience, skills, and achievements.
05
Proofread the form to avoid any spelling or grammatical errors.
06
Submit the form within the given deadline.

How should a bio data be written?
A biodata document will include basic details such as your name, gender, date of birth, address, the names of your parents and your email address. You'll also want to include information about your hobbies, passions, what you're good at and anything else you think the employer might need to understand you as a person.
What is bio data for interview?
The biodata generally contains the same type of information as a résumé (i.e. objective, work history, salary information, educational background), but may also include physical attributes, such as height, weight, hair/skin/eye color, and a photo.
